Gowda's bid to pin down BJP One of Deve Gowda's conditions to the BJP is that, an Yeddyurappa-led dispensation cannot "alter or annul" the Cabinet decisions with respect to "on-going developmental projects and other important works of public importance."
JD(U) MLA, goons attack scribes The credo of good governance in Bihar suffered a severe setback when ruling party legislator Anant Singh and his goons held NDTV reporter Prakash Singh captive and assaulted three other newsmen here on Thursday.
Cong's new strategy to expose Modi govt It may have failed to get any direct and positive result from its Mulayam Ki Loot slogan in Uttar Pradesh, but the Congress believes its strategy to expose Modi Ka Jhooth (lies of Modi) would help it hit pay dirt in the forthcoming Gujarat polls.
Left firm on nuclear stand After CPM General Secretary Prakash Karat, it was the turn of his CPI counterpart A B Bardhan to spell out on Thursday that there won't be any change in the Left's position on the nuclear issue.
